Detroit Tigers pitcher Jack Flaherty is gearing up to face the Cleveland Guardians in what could potentially be one of his final starts with the team. Flaherty, who has been performing exceptionally well this season with a 7-5 record and a 3.13 ERA, is on the radar for a potential trade as the deadline approaches.

Flaherty has been a key player for the Tigers, boasting a 6-1 record with a 2.04 ERA since the end of May. In his recent outing against the Toronto Blue Jays, he allowed just two runs and two hits while striking out eight batters over 5 2/3 innings in a 5-4 victory for Detroit.

Teammate Mark Canha praised Flaherty’s consistency and performance, highlighting his contributions to the team. The Tigers, who are currently in the middle of an 11-4 stretch, are looking to bounce back after a close 5-4 loss to the Guardians in their previous game.

On the other side, the Guardians will be sending Tanner Bibee to the mound, who has struggled against the Tigers in the past with a 0-3 record and a 6.86 ERA in four career starts. Bibee will be looking to improve on his recent performance, where he pitched a solid game against the San Diego Padres, allowing only two hits over 5 2/3 innings in a 7-0 victory for Cleveland.

Star player Jose Ramirez has been a standout performer for the Guardians, hitting his first home run since June and delivering key hits to help secure a win for the team. Ramirez has been a force to be reckoned with against Detroit, boasting a .343 batting average with two home runs and seven RBIs in nine games this season.
